Robberg beach

This blue-flag coast is said to be the best on the Garden Route. You can stroll for kilometers over seemingly endless sands, and chances are you’ll encounter dolphins along the way. During the winter months, when the southern right whales visit Plettenberg Bay, this place is also famed for shore-based whale spotting. This place is a must-see along the Garden Route.

Boulders beach

Boulders shore is a unique beach on the Cape Peninsula. It is not a typical one though. A penguin colony has taken up residence on the coast! You are welcome to dive in and observe the penguins from the water, but you must maintain a safe distance. To avoid the crowds, we recommend arriving at Boulders early. Boulders is also close to Simon’s Town, which is well worth a visit.

Sodwana bay beach

Sodwana Bay National Park, part of the iSimangaliso Wetland Park, is located between St Lucia and Lake Sibaya. Stunning golden shores can be found here, and the area is particularly well-known for its beautiful coral reefs, which make it one of the rainbow nations greatest diving locations. Many different types of fish, rays, sharks, gigantic turtles, and even whales can be seen. Don’t like diving? Then relax and enjoy the beautiful shore and various water activities offered.

Clifton beach

The four areas of Clifton Beach are divided by enormous boulders. Swimming is feasible here, however the Atlantic Ocean can be quite cold. The advantage of their placing is that they are virtually always wind-free due to their placement in the bay. The area is particularly popular with residents, and each shore has its own crowd. The first attracts both swimmers and surfers, while the second has numerous sand volleyball courts. According to locals, the third one is the most gay-friendly. Finally, the fourth one is thought to be the greatest for a peaceful afternoon with the family.

Camps bay

The beach at Camps Bay is a popular destination in Cape Town. The view of Lion’s Head and the Twelve Apostles from this area is spectacular. Camps Bay is Cape Town’s wealthiest neighbourhood. There are numerous restaurants and bars in this area. This place’s downside is that it is frequently crowded. Furthermore, when the wind blows in the city, the wind at Camps Bay blows twice as hard.
